Sensor, Air Temperature, Intake: Removal: 6.2L

The Inlet Air Temperature (IAT) sensor is installed into the rubber air intake hose near the front of the throttle body.

  1. Disconnect and isolate the negative battery cable.

  2. Disconnect the IAT sensor wire harness connector (1).

  3. Lifting up on the lock tab turn the IAT sensor (1) 1/4 turn counterclockwise and remove the IAT sensor from the rubber air intake hose.

  4. Inspect the sensor probe for any damage.
  5. Clean any dirt or debris from sensor base.
